For a given distribution of marks, mean is 35.16 and its standard deviation is 19.76. The coefficient of variation is :

A

`(19.76)/(35.16) xx 10`

B

`(35.16)/(19.76) xx 100`

C

`(19.76)/(35.16)`

D

None of these

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B
